学习法兰克编程软件可以遵循以下步骤:
学习编程语言
法兰克编程软件支持多种编程语言,如G代码和M代码。G代码用于控制车床的运动轨迹,M代码用于控制辅助功能,如切削液的喷洒等。首先需要学习这些编程语言的基本语法和命令。
掌握软件界面
熟悉法兰克编程软件的界面和各种功能按钮,了解如何创建新程序、打开和保存程序文件等操作。
编写基本程序
从简单的程序开始,逐步学习如何编写车床程序。可以从一些简单的工件开始,如圆柱体、孔等,逐步增加难度。
理解车床的刀具和工件坐标系
学习如何正确设置刀具和工件坐标系,以确保程序的准确性。
调试和优化程序
学习如何调试和优化程序,以提高加工效率和质量。可以通过模拟加工过程、调整切削参数等方式进行优化。
学习法兰克编程语言
法兰克车床编程使用一种特定的编程语言,称为G代码。学习G代码的语法、指令和参数设置是编写车床程序的基础。了解G代码的基本结构和常用指令,能够编写简单的车床程序。
使用仿真软件
可以使用仿真软件如FANUC Roboguide进行学习和调试。它提供了一个虚拟的机器人环境,用户可以在其中编写和测试程序,模拟机器人的运动和操作。
掌握编程工具
学习使用编程开发工具包如FANUC PCDK,它提供了丰富的函数库和工具,可以帮助用户更方便地编写和调试程序。
使用手持式编程器
FANUC Teach Pendant是一个手持式编程器,可以用于现场编写和调试法兰克编程。它提供了一个简单直观的界面,用户可以通过手持式编程器直接控制机器人的运动和操作。
学习KAREL语言
KAREL是法兰克机器人公司提供的一种编程语言,用于编写法兰克机器人的控制程序。用户可以通过学习和使用KAREL语言来实现机器人的自动化操作。
实践项目
进行一些小型的编程项目和练习,以加深对所学知识的理解和应用。同时,建议阅读相关的编程书籍和参考资料,参与编程社区和论坛的讨论,与其他编程初学者进行交流和分享经验。
通过以上步骤,你可以逐步掌握法兰克编程软件,并能够进行实际的车床编程工作。